China's Stock Market Meltdown: Investors Scarred and Foreign Investors Flee

China's recent $2tn stock market rout has left investors feeling wary and uncertain, with many describing the market as "uninvestable." The sharp decline in Chinese stocks has been attributed to a variety of factors, including regulatory crackdowns, concerns about economic growth, and the impact of the Evergrande debt crisis. The volatility in the Chinese market has led to significant losses for investors and has raised doubts about the stability and attractiveness of investing in Chinese stocks.
